Changeset f59212cc in mainline for uspace/app/nav/menu.h


Ignore:
Timestamp:
2021-10-25T00:32:45Z (2 years ago)
Author:
jxsvoboda <5887334+jxsvoboda@…>
Branches:
master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
c632c96
Parents:
5bbb4453
git-author:
Jiri Svoboda <jiri@…> (2021-10-19 20:54:17)
git-committer:
jxsvoboda <5887334+jxsvoboda@…> (2021-10-25 00:32:45)
Message:

Add File / Open, properly deliver menu events to Navigator

File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/app/nav/menu.h

    r5bbb4453 rf59212cc  
    3838
    3939#include <errno.h>
     40#include <ui/menuentry.h>
    4041#include <ui/window.h>
    4142#include "types/menu.h"
    4243
    4344extern errno_t nav_menu_create(ui_window_t *, nav_menu_t **);
     45extern void nav_menu_set_cb(nav_menu_t *, nav_menu_cb_t *, void *);
    4446extern void nav_menu_destroy(nav_menu_t *);
    4547extern ui_control_t *nav_menu_ctl(nav_menu_t *);
     48extern void nav_menu_file_open(ui_menu_entry_t *, void *);
     49extern void nav_menu_file_exit(ui_menu_entry_t *, void *);
    4650
    4751#endif
Note: See TracChangeset for help on using the changeset viewer.